
要将工作表移进Excel表格,可以使用“拖放法”、“右键菜单法”和“移动或复制工作表”三种方法。 其中,“右键菜单法”是最简单且高效的方法。通过这种方法,可以在Excel工作表标签上右键单击,选择“移动或复制”,然后选择目标工作簿或新建工作簿,以实现将工作表移入其他Excel文件。以下将详细介绍这三种方法,并附上相关的操作步骤和注意事项。
一、拖放法
拖放法是最直观的方法,尤其适用于同一Excel工作簿内的工作表移动。
操作步骤:
- 打开包含目标工作表的Excel文件。
- 选择要移动的工作表标签,按住鼠标左键不放。
- 拖动工作表标签到目标位置,然后松开鼠标左键。
注意事项:
- 确保拖动过程中不要松开鼠标左键,否则可能中途停止移动。
- 如果需要跨工作簿移动工作表,拖放法不适用。
二、右键菜单法
右键菜单法是最为灵活和高效的方法,适用于在同一工作簿内或跨工作簿移动工作表。
操作步骤:
- 打开包含目标工作表的Excel文件。
- 在工作表标签上右键单击,选择“移动或复制”选项。
- 在弹出的对话框中,选择目标工作簿或新建工作簿。
- 选择目标位置,并勾选“创建副本”选项(可选)。
- 点击“确定”完成移动。
注意事项:
- 使用此方法可以在同一工作簿内或跨工作簿移动工作表。
- 如果勾选“创建副本”,将会在目标位置生成一个新的工作表副本,而原工作表保留在原位置。
三、移动或复制工作表
这种方法适用于需要更精细控制工作表移动的情况,特别是在复杂的Excel文件中。
操作步骤:
- 打开包含目标工作表的Excel文件。
- 选择要移动的工作表标签,右键单击后选择“移动或复制”。
- 在弹出的对话框中,选择目标工作簿或新建工作簿。
- 在“工作表之前”下拉菜单中选择目标位置。
- 点击“确定”完成移动。
注意事项:
- 确保目标工作簿已经打开,否则无法选择。
- 如果目标工作簿包含相同名称的工作表,可能会提示重命名。
四、使用VBA代码移动工作表
对于需要批量移动工作表或进行复杂操作的用户,VBA代码提供了更高效的解决方案。
操作步骤:
- 打开Excel文件,按
Alt + F11打开VBA编辑器。 - 在VBA编辑器中,插入一个新模块。
- 输入以下代码:
Sub 移动工作表()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1") ' 更改为你的工作表名称
ws.Move Before:=Workbooks("目标工作簿.xlsx").Sheets(1) ' 更改为你的目标工作簿名称
End Sub
- 关闭VBA编辑器,按
Alt + F8运行宏。
注意事项:
- 确保目标工作簿已经打开。
- 修改代码中的工作表和工作簿名称以匹配实际情况。
五、使用Power Query移动数据
对于需要将数据从一个工作表移动到另一个工作表的用户,可以使用Power Query工具。
操作步骤:
- 打开Excel文件,选择“数据”选项卡。
- 点击“获取数据”按钮,选择“从工作簿中”。
- 选择包含目标数据的Excel文件,然后点击“导入”。
- 在Power Query编辑器中,选择目标工作表,并进行必要的数据转换。
- 点击“关闭并加载”按钮,将数据加载到目标工作表。
注意事项:
- Power Query适用于需要进行数据转换和清洗的情况。
- 确保目标工作簿已经保存并关闭。
六、使用插件和第三方工具
除了Excel自带的方法,还可以使用一些插件和第三方工具来实现工作表的移动。
常用插件:
- ASAP Utilities
- Kutools for Excel
操作步骤:
- 安装并启用插件。
- 根据插件提供的功能,选择工作表移动选项。
- 按照提示完成工作表的移动。
注意事项:
- 插件和第三方工具可能需要购买授权。
- 确保下载和安装的插件来自可靠来源。
七、总结
将工作表移进Excel表格是一个常见的操作,本文介绍了多种方法,包括拖放法、右键菜单法、移动或复制工作表、使用VBA代码、使用Power Query和使用插件和第三方工具。每种方法都有其独特的优点和适用场景,用户可以根据具体需求选择最合适的方法。
通过本文的介绍,读者可以掌握多种移动工作表的方法,并能根据实际情况选择最佳解决方案,提高工作效率。无论是简单的拖放操作,还是复杂的VBA代码,都能满足不同用户的需求,帮助他们更好地管理和组织Excel工作表。
相关问答FAQs:
1. 如何将工作表移动到Excel表格的特定位置?
- 首先,在Excel中选择要移动的工作表的名称标签。
- 其次,拖动并将该工作表的名称标签移到您想要放置的位置。
- 最后,释放鼠标按钮,工作表将被移动到新的位置。
2. 在Excel中如何将工作表移动到另一个工作簿?
- 首先,打开源工作簿和目标工作簿。
- 其次,选择源工作簿中要移动的工作表的名称标签。
- 然后,按住Ctrl键并拖动该工作表的名称标签到目标工作簿的标签栏上。
- 最后,释放鼠标按钮,工作表将被移动到目标工作簿。
3. 如何在Excel中将多个工作表合并到一个工作表中?
- 首先,打开包含多个工作表的Excel文件。
- 其次,在目标工作表中选择要合并的第一个工作表的单元格范围。
- 然后,按住Shift键并单击要合并的最后一个工作表的名称标签,以选择所有要合并的工作表。
- 接下来,复制所选工作表的内容。
- 最后,粘贴到目标工作表中,合并的工作表的数据将显示在目标工作表中。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4633948